This is an office and residential building in Tokyo. The large steel frame is constructed with a series of openings in high positions to allow light and wind to pass through. The plan surrounds a courtyard, and the openings on the courtyard side create a sense of unity between the interior and exterior through the use of huge fabricated fittings.
